As a Regulatory Analyst, you'll provide technical and analytical support across a wide range of responsibilities, including:
- supporting the team with near real-time reporting of overflow discharges via the Wessex Water Coast and Rivers Watch web map. This includes management and quality assurance of data to ensure accurate and timely reporting
- be responsible for daily exception checks, highlighting issues for investigation and working with operational teams to resolve them
- supporting the business to meet the MCERTS certification programme for Operator Self-Monitoring, this includes booking of site inspections, raising purchase orders and maintaining corporate records
- weekly, monthly and annual reporting of regulatory EDM and flow data to support Wessex Water to meet the Environmental Permitting Regulations and Environmental legislation
- liaising with and responding to requests from regulators and external bodies, such as the Environment Agency, Ofwat, Defra and customers following an Environmental Information Request. This includes providing written reports and action plans to demonstrate compliance and support regulatory investigations where required
- provide analytical support to the Flow Compliance Adviser, enabling the identification of trends in performance and compliance. You'll help transform complex environmental data into meaningful insights that support regulatory compliance and business decision-making
- work to a quality management system and support the Flow Compliance Adviser to ensure that policies and procedures are followed and updated as required
- support the team to develop and enhance current reporting processes and software, to deliver high-quality and accurate outputs whilst improving efficiency.
